I subscribe to Omnisky (AT&T) for the Palm (using a Vx, tho they have modems for the III form-factor, too):
-That service has its own "OmniSky" browser, which very nicely displays regular HTML/WWW pages instead of WAP.
-You can view WAP pages from AvantGo, but AvantGo will also fairly well display regular HTML/WWW pages (altho they are not
reformated like OmniSky does, so you have to scroll left & right to see the whole page, which can be a bother).
-You can view WAP pages even better with KBrowser (www.4thPass.com) -- at least when viewing mobile.h2g2.com, buttons look like buttons using KBrowser, but not when using AvantGo, and more buttons show up on the screen with KBrowser than with AvantGo.
-The best way to use a Palm browser, howver, would be for h2g2 to use "PQA" files -- they would allow the OmniSky browser or AvantGO to more easily access special PQA-ready pages (about half-way between regular HTML/WWW pages & WAP pages), and the AvantGo servers could even download content into the Palm for viewing offline...
